Enjoyable now with aeration, this 2021 has the structure and acidity to evolve beautifully over the next 6–8 years, gaining complexity and softening its youthful edges.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eProduction\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cbr\u003eLe Haut de la Butte comes from the estate’s highest-lying parcel in Bourgueil, a six-hectare single vineyard rooted in limestone bedrock interlayered with clay and silex (flint). This elevated, well-drained terroir naturally limits vigor and concentrates flavor while preserving notable freshness in the grapes. Harvesting is typically done by hand, with careful selection of bunches to ensure only optimally ripe Cabernet Franc is brought to the cellar. Vinification follows Jacky Blot’s philosophy of minimal intervention: gentle extraction to favor finesse over power, native ferments when conditions allow, and judicious use of oak. The wine is only partially aged in new barriques, with the remainder in older barrels, so that the élevage polishes the tannins and adds texture without masking the clarity of fruit and the mineral signature of the site.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eFood \u0026amp; Serving\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cbr\u003eLe Haut de la Butte 2021 is a versatile red that shines alongside dishes that echo its savory, herbal complexity. Decanting for 30–60 minutes is recommended in its youth to tame the initial wildness on the nose and allow the dark fruit, floral tones, and minerality to fully unfold.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eProducer\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cbr\u003eDomaine de la Butte, led for many years by the acclaimed vigneron Jacky Blot, is one of the reference estates for Cabernet Franc in the Loire’s Bourgueil appellation. Blot, already renowned for his groundbreaking work with Montlouis and Vouvray whites, applied the same precision and terroir-driven mindset to red wine at Domaine de la Butte. The property is a patchwork of distinct parcels on the Bourgueil hillside, each vinified separately to capture its individual character. Through meticulous vineyard work, low yields, and a restrained, artisanal approach in the cellar, the domaine has helped redefine what Bourgueil can be: elegant, ageworthy, and intensely expressive of site. Today, wines like Le Haut de la Butte stand as key benchmarks for the region and carry forward the legacy of one of the Loire’s most influential producers.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Domaine de la Butte SCEA J Blot","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":54252575850833,"sku":"VC-13164","price":27.31,"currency_code":"EUR","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0874\/0614\/9969\/files\/bild_domaine_de_la_butte_le_haut_de_la_butte_bourgueil_2021_1280x1280_70da16fe-7325-4cc7-8ece-eba6aba69c69.jpg?v=1783445214","url":"https:\/\/bottlehero.com\/products\/domaine-de-la-butte-le-haut-de-la-butte-bourgueil-2021","provider":"Bottle Hero","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
